Value Partners Goes Live with SunGard’s Monis for Pricing and Risk Analysis of Fixed Income and Credit

Value Partners, an independent asset management company based in Hong Kong, has implemented SunGard’s Monis XL pricing and risk solution for convertibles and fixed income trading. The Monis solution will help Value Partners to value convertible bonds and credit linked derivatives within its pre- and post-trade analysis.

Value Partners uses a disciplined approach to managing authorised funds, absolute return long biased funds, long-short hedge funds, private equity funds and quantitative funds. To support this approach, Value Partners selected Monis to help it independently price derivatives in-house, identify future risks, and integrate with internal systems. The solution also helps to support Value Partners’ plan to increase its asset allocation of fixed income products.

Fawaz Habel, senior fund manager of Value Partners, said: “Monis provides us with a flexible and robust solution for trading convertibles, fixed income and credit-linked derivatives. Since it is widely used by both sell side and buy side firms, Monis’ pricing is well understood and recognised. Monis will help us identify value in our trade decisions. We’re also pleased that SunGard offered a rapid implementation schedule, local support and easy integration with our existing systems.”

Emanuel Mond, president of SunGard’s alternative investments business, said: “Accuracy of valuation and risk is crucial for asset managers to bring confidence and insight into trade decisions. It can help them to take decisive action, particularly in highly volatile markets. As a leading solution for convertible and fixed income pricing, particularly in Asia, Monis can help firms like Value Partners to efficiently conduct sensitivity and risk analyses and develop fixed income and debt trading strategies.”
